14h - 15h : Luca Rossi
Valeur propre principale généralisée dans des cadres non compacts
On se pose la question de trouver un analogue de la valeur propre principale pour des opérateurs dont la résolvante n'est pas compacte. On considère d'abord le cas ou la non compacité est due au fait que le domaine est non borne, ou on montre qu'on a besoin de plusieurs notions pour caractériser les propriétés de la valeur propre principale concernant l'existence de fonctions propres positives et le principe du maximum. Ensuite, on traitera le cas des opérateurs dégénérés dans le cadre des solutions de viscosité.

15h15 - 16h15 : Jian Fang
On the propagation direction of bistable waves in a nonlocal reaction-diffusion equation
In this paper, we observe that varying the rate of symmetric non-local interaction in a reaction-diffusion equation may alter the propagation direction of bistable traveling waves. To ensure such a phenomena happens or not happen, we give some sufficient explicit conditions.

9h45 - 10h45 : Grégory Faye
A dynamical systems approach to some nonlocal problems
In this talk, we will present some recent results on nonlocal problems using ideas from dynamical systems theory. In a first part, we will study propagation failure in nonlocal Allen-Cahn equations and present results on unpinning asymptotics for the wave speed (as one approaches the pinning region) using singular perturbations theory. In a second part, we analyze the existence of traveling pulses for the Fitz-Hugh Nagumo equations when the diffusion is nonlocal. Here, the proof relies on matched asymptotics techniques and Fredholm properties of differential operators on suitable Banach spaces. Finally, if times allows, we will study the existence of periodic states and modulated traveling waves in the nonlocal Fisher-KPP using center manifold techniques.
